Understanding Digital Money Systems

A digital money system, often referred to as a cryptocurrency or virtual currency system, is a decentralized form of currency that relies on cryptographic techniques to facilitate secure financial transactions. Unlike traditional fiat currencies issued by central authorities such as governments or central banks, digital currencies operate on decentralized networks based on blockchain technology.

Key Components of Digital Money Systems

Blockchain Technology: At the core of digital money systems lies blockchain technology, a distributed ledger that records all transactions across a network of computers. Each transaction is cryptographically secured and verified by network participants, ensuring transparency and immutability.

Cryptographic Techniques: Digital currencies utilize cryptographic techniques such as public-key cryptography to secure transactions and control the creation of new units. Public and private keys are used to authenticate users and authorize transactions on the blockchain.

Decentralized Governance: Unlike traditional financial systems governed by central authorities, digital money systems operate on decentralized networks governed by consensus mechanisms such as Proof of Work (PoW) or Proof of Stake (PoS). This decentralization ensures resilience against censorship and single points of failure.

Smart Contracts: Many digital currency platforms support smart contracts, self-executing contracts with the terms of the agreement directly written into code. Smart contracts enable automated and programmable transactions, expanding the utility of digital currencies beyond simple value transfer.

Types of Digital Money Systems

Cryptocurrencies: Cryptocurrencies like Bitcoin, Ethereum, and Litecoin are decentralized digital assets designed as mediums of exchange. They operate independently of central banks and traditional financial institutions, offering users greater financial sovereignty and privacy.

Stablecoins: Stablecoins are digital currencies pegged to stable assets such as fiat currencies (e.g., USD, EUR) or commodities (e.g., gold). These assets provide price stability and serve as a bridge between the volatility of cryptocurrencies and the stability of traditional fiat currencies.

Central Bank Digital Currencies (CBDCs): CBDCs are digital representations of fiat currencies issued by central banks. Unlike cryptocurrencies, CBDCs are centralized and regulated by government authorities, offering the benefits of digital currencies while retaining the oversight and stability of traditional monetary systems.

Functionality of Digital Money Systems

Peer-to-Peer Transactions: Digital money systems enable peer-to-peer transactions without the need for intermediaries such as banks or payment processors. Users can send and receive funds directly, reducing transaction costs and increasing efficiency.

Global Accessibility: Digital currencies transcend geographical boundaries, allowing users to transact across borders without the need for currency conversion or intermediaries. This global accessibility fosters financial inclusion and empowers individuals in underserved regions to participate in the global economy.

Immutable Ledger: The transparent and immutable nature of blockchain technology ensures the integrity of transactions recorded on the ledger. Once a transaction is confirmed and added to the blockchain, it cannot be altered or tampered with, providing a high level of security and trust.

Micropayments and Programmable Money: Digital money systems enable micropayments and programmable money, allowing for new forms of digital commerce and innovative financial applications. Smart contracts enable automated payment settlements, escrow services, and decentralized finance (DeFi) protocols.

Regulatory Considerations

The rapid growth of digital money systems has prompted regulatory scrutiny from governments and financial authorities worldwide. Regulatory frameworks vary by jurisdiction and often seek to balance innovation with consumer protection, financial stability, and anti-money laundering (AML) compliance.

AML/KYC Regulations: Many countries have implemented anti-money laundering (AML) and know-your-customer (KYC) regulations to prevent illicit activities such as money laundering, terrorism financing, and fraud. Digital currency exchanges and service providers are required to implement robust AML/KYC procedures to ensure compliance with regulatory requirements.

Taxation: Taxation of digital currencies varies by jurisdiction and depends on factors such as the classification of digital assets, capital gains tax regulations, and reporting requirements. Governments are increasingly adopting tax policies to address the growing use of digital currencies and ensure tax compliance.

Securities Regulation: Regulatory agencies are scrutinizing digital assets to determine whether they qualify as securities under existing securities laws. Tokens issued through initial coin offerings (ICOs) or token sales may be subject to securities regulation, including registration requirements and investor protections.

Consumer Protection: Regulatory authorities aim to protect consumers from fraud, scams, and market manipulation in the digital currency space. Consumer protection measures may include disclosure requirements, investor education initiatives, and enforcement actions against fraudulent schemes.
